    Can anyone inform me of what type of sword this is or where it was possibly manufactured? the blade is about 9.5" long and the handle is about 5". There is a wire at the end of the sheath that connects to a heart/leaf. The 3 decorative pieces on each side appear to be glass and the blade of the sword is not sharp at all and is meant to be a decorative piece. Any and all information would be greatly appreciated and thank you in advance!
